## Releases

Glimview, the audit-log viewer, ships as signed tarballs on a biweekly cadence. Reviewers should check that the release commit matches the tagged build and that the changelog covers schema migrations. Every artifact is verified in CI before publication. Verify downloaded releases against the project signing key shown below.

release key, fahaf-bajof: bky3_Xam

**Runbook: Scanhawk barcode integration**

Quick orientation for reviewers: Scanhawk bridges the warehouse handheld scanners to our inventory service at Corbin Yard. Scans land on a local relay, get normalized (we strip checksum digits — yes, really), then post upstream. If scans stop flowing, restart the relay first; it wedges more often than we'd like. When testing a branch, run the relay against staging only. The staging relay authenticates to the inventory service with the key below.

API key for tagef-fafop: vxb2-ta

## Break-glass access — Ormwright refactor

Hey reviewer: the legacy ORM layer in Tallowby is mid-refactor, so half the models go through the new mapper and half through the old one. If a migration wedges the schema registry during review, don't hand-edit tables — use the break-glass console instead. It rolls the registry back to the last good snapshot and pauses the mapper. The console is deliberately annoying to open: it prompts for the recovery passphrase, which is:

vault phrase of kafog-kahif = holdor-rusir-praox